This spell will allow the caster to divine the nature of spells cast in an area, spells cast on a person or item and the type of Spell Caster who cast the spells being investigated.
While casting this spell the spell caster must roll an Arcana Check DC 12 +1 per level over 3. Thus investigating a level 5 spell will take an Arcana roll DC 14, and a level 9 spell will require a DC 21. By expending a higher level spell slot the caster can reduce the DC of the spell investigated by a point per level over 3.
With a successful roll the caster may determine 1 thing for every point of Proficiency the Caster has:
1 Time of death of a corpse that was killed by magic.
2 What spells were cast in an area for the last 72 hours and time of Spells Cast. (If the Investigator has an 18 or higher in INT then this time frame is an additional 24 hours back per point.)
3 Type of Spell Caster who cast the spells. If multi class caster this is not reveled, the information gleaned will be that the caster was a type of what ever spell list the spell was cast from.
4 Where the spell caster was standing when the spell was cast.
5 Approximate level of Spell Caster. Level 1-3 Basic, Level 4-7 Competent, Level 8-11 Skilled, Level 12-15 Master, Level 16-20 Legendary.
6 Species of the Spell Caster. This spell will not however determine subspecies. You can determine an Elf cast the spell, but not that a Forest Elf cast the spell.
7 Material Components used in the spells.
8 If the spell was cast via an object or from a spell casters memory. If cast from an item if with was cast via a scroll, wand or other item, this can be determined with a second Arcana roll goal of 15.
* - (Silver dust worth 1 Gold)
